Muleriders head to Kansas for 2025 Washburn Open

MAGNOLIA, Ark. - The Mulerider Women's and Men's Track and Field are back in action for the second time this indoor season as they are heading to Topeka, Kansas to compete at the 2025 Washburn Open. Washburn University hosts the event and it will take place over two days (Jan. 31-Feb. 1). With a full slate of sprints, distance races, jumps, and throws, the Muleriders will have plenty of opportunities to test themselves early in the season. 

The schedule is packed with events across two days, featuring a variety of combined, running, and field events for both men and women. On Friday, the day kicks off at 11:00 AM with the men's heptathlon events, including the 60m dash, long jump, shot put, and high jump. Running events begin at 11:30 AM with the 3000m race, followed by various sprint and distance races, including the 60m dash qualifiers, distance medley relays, and the 5000m run, which closes the day at 5:30 PM. Field events include the women's pole vault at 11:30 AM, men's and women's triple jump at 2:00 PM, and conclude with high jump at 3:30 PM.

On Saturday the heptathlon and pentathlon continues, starting at 10:00 AM with the men's heptathlon 60m hurdles. Running events begin at 12:30 PM with the 3000m runs, followed by hurdles, dashes, miles, and relays. The evening will conclude with the men's and women's 4x400m relays at 7:35 PM and 8:20 PM, respectively. Meanwhile, field events feature men's and women's shot put, pole vault, long jump, and high jump.

Last weekend's performance was highlighted by Diamond Brunn and Keith Smith. Brunn delivered a standout performance in the long jump and claimed 1st place with a jump of 5.43m. Smith recorded a new personal best in the triple jump and earned 2nd place with a leap of 14.74m. He also earned Great American Conference Men's Field Athlete of the Week after his performance at the Rumble in the Jungle Invitational.
